Main duties of the job

Can you remain calm and assertive in challenging situations? Are you looking for a rewarding role where no two calls are the same? Do you have the right attitude and skills to help us deliver our Mission of Right Care, Right Place, Right Time?

You will be answering calls from the public for the NHS 111 Wales Service (part of the Welsh Ambulance Service NHS Trust).

The ability to actively listen, make considered decisions and respond quickly and confidently is key to this role. The successful applicants will need to demonstrate they have worked as part of a team, ideally with a call centre background and will possess excellent communication skills. Excellent computer and keyboard skills are required as you will be entering patient information speedily and accurately onto a computer system.

Equally important is an ability to treat our patients with dignity, empathy and respect. For successful candidates, training will be provided and paid on a full-time basis (daytime hours for 5 weeks) and you must be able to commit to this and complete the training.

The ability to speak Welsh is desirable for this post; Welsh and/or English speakers are equally welcome to apply.

You must be aged 18 or over to start in this role.
